quote:

I for one am excited to drag up old threads about him being a terrible in game coach to remind everyone why this is a lazy hire.

Wade is usually great at scouting and attention to detail in pre-gameday prep. His in-game coaching has considerable room for improvement.

But LSU had a consistent winning product with him and an SEC Championship, so we know he is capable of winning considerably in the SEC as well. So I'm not sure the lazy hire thing applies here because he was quite successful at LSU (and he had success at VCU and McNeese as well). And I'm sure there were some decent challenges with trying to bring him back here. If he does indeed become the coach again...

quote:

I for one am excited to drag up old threads about him being a terrible in game coach to remind everyone why this is a lazy hire.

How can it be a lazy hire when he has the highest winning percentage of any LSU men's basketball coach in more than 100 years. That includes Dale Brown, Harry Rabenhorst and John Brady. His overall winning percentage (.696) is close to that of Nate Oats at Alabama (.702), though Oats has obviously advanced further in the postseason. It's also not a lazy hire if you're looking for someone to come in and immediately re-energize the program.
